History
The Adrian Training School is operated under the jurisdiction of the Office of Delinquency Services within DSS. The school is a residential treatment center for adjudicated youth between the ages of 12 and 21. The school has been a coeducational medium security institution since January 1973. There are no walls or fences surrounding the facility.
The school is a 120-bed facility composed of six cottages, each with a 20-bed capacity, and serves 80 males and 40 females. At the time of it's closure, the on-campus population was 120 and the school had 125 employees. The facility was closed as part of budget cuts and reuse for the property has not yet been decided.
